All you need to know about the Tidsbanken standard integration
Overview
With this integration you will connect Simployer One to your Tidsbanken account via API and can then do the following:
Scheduled or manual sync of employee data such as personal information, employment data, compensation data and more from Simployer One to Tidsbanken
Sync time off data such as sickness, parental leave and vacations to Tidsbanken for the period that you choose. You have full control over what absences are exported for what employees and for what period
Available in: Norway
Tidsbanken requirements
You need to have access to the following valid credentials.
- Employee token: this can be found in the Tidsbanken help center article here.
- Log in as Administrator: Access Tidsbanken’s web portal using an administrator account; only admins can retrieve the tb-key
- Open the Integration Center: Click the wrench icon (settings) in the bottom right corner of the portal
- Select "Integrasjoner": From the menu, choose "Integrasjoner" to enter the integration center
- Locate Your API Key (tb-key): Your tb-key (API key) will be shown here. This is the key you need for integrations and should be input as "tb-key" in integration setups.[](https://developer.tidsbanken.net/migrating-from-api-v1-to-api-v3)
- Copy and Use Your tb-key: Copy the tb-key and input it in the Simployer integration setup wizard (step 2) when prompted.
Adding the integration
The integration is activated from Settings → Integrations → Add Integration
- In the API Integrations section, select Tidsbanken
- Click Next to start the configuration wizard
- Enter the tb-key from earlier into the field in Step 2
Settings
You can choose how the integration sync for employees is executed. The options available are as follows:
Manual sync
The data is manually synced to Tidsbanken by the user
This can be valuable if you have the scheduled sync turned off and want to control when data is synced to Tidsbanken. Either during the implementation phase or during times when an update is not wanted due to process and payroll timing
Manual syncs can be performed even when a scheduled sync is configured. This may be necessary if there have been a significant number of changes in Simployer One after a scheduled sync has been executed
Scheduled sync
The sync runs on a schedule that you can define
Options include the day(s) of the week and the time of day for the sync to be executed

Note: when a scheduled sync is enabled, it is queued and executed shortly after 06:00 CET the following day.
Scope
Scopes allow more granular filters that determine which employees are included in the employee sync
This is especially useful if you require a specific set of employees to be excluded from the export to Tidsbanken.
Scopes follow the same scope behavior as seen in other Simployer One features.
Employee data
Employee data is synchronized from Simployer One to Tidsbanken. This means that if data is updated in Tidsbanken on "data fields" and then the sync from Simployer One is done the data in Tidsbanken will be overwritten.
When the sync is executed it will compare the data in Simployer for the "data fields" to see if there is a difference between the values for those fields in Tidsbanken. If there is no change, the user will not be updated. If there is a change present, the data will be updated.
Some fields are currently hardcoded or have a default value, see the table below for more information.
Data fields
Simployer field | Tidsbanken field | Mapping conditions & notes |
---|---|---|
id | EksternId | |
employeeNumber | Id | Required |
firstName | Fornavn | Required |
lastName | Etternavn | Required |
workEmail / privateEmail | Epost | Work email used as default — fallback to private email if work email is missing |
workPhone | Mobil | |
workPhone | TlfPrivat | |
birthDate | Fodt | |
homeAddress.street | Adresse | |
homeAddress.postalCode | Postnummer | |
homeAddress.city | Poststed | |
title | Tittel | |
hireDate | AnsattDato | |
employment.rate | Stillingsprosent | |
ssn | Personnummer | |
bankAccount.number | Lonnskonto | |
departmentId | AvdelingId | Required |
employment.type | AnsattGruppeId |
Absence data
Expected release in September 2025.
Was this article helpful?
That’s Great!
Thank you for your feedback
Sorry! We couldn't be helpful
Thank you for your feedback
Feedback sent
We appreciate your effort and will try to fix the article